源代码1 项目: lams   文件: AbstractPersistentCollection.java
@Override
public boolean needsRecreate(CollectionPersister persister) {
	// Workaround for situations like HHH-7072.  If the collection element is a component that consists entirely
	// of nullable properties, we currently have to forcefully recreate the entire collection.  See the use
	// of hasNotNullableColumns in the AbstractCollectionPersister constructor for more info.  In order to delete
	// row-by-row, that would require SQL like "WHERE ( COL = ? OR ( COL is null AND ? is null ) )", rather than
	// the current "WHERE COL = ?" (fails for null for most DBs).  Note that
	// the param would have to be bound twice.  Until we eventually add "parameter bind points" concepts to the
	// AST in ORM 5+, handling this type of condition is either extremely difficult or impossible.  Forcing
	// recreation isn't ideal, but not really any other option in ORM 4.
	// Selecting a type used in where part of update statement
	// (must match condidion in org.hibernate.persister.collection.BasicCollectionPersister.doUpdateRows).
	// See HHH-9474
	Type whereType;
	if ( persister.hasIndex() ) {
		whereType = persister.getIndexType();
	}
	else {
		whereType = persister.getElementType();
	}
	if ( whereType instanceof CompositeType ) {
		CompositeType componentIndexType = (CompositeType) whereType;
		return !componentIndexType.hasNotNullProperty();
	}
	return false;
}
